In reply to: [HTML Post Editor] Saving as draft clears all HTML dataHi. Please tell me exact steps to reproduce it.
I tried to add some text on the HTML tab and clicked Save Draft. The added text is not saved but the previous content is not removed. This is expected behaviour according to the plugin Description, section Usage.4. The content should be synchronized with the HTML tab content. So you should first switch to the Visual tab before saving.Forum: Plugins
